Munich Airport reopens after drone sightings forced overnight closure

Munich Airport was temporarily shut down overnight after several drone sightings in the area, the latest mysterious drone overflights in the airspace of European Union member countries, officials said.

Germany’s air traffic control restricted flights at the airport shortly after 10pm local time on Thursday and then halted them altogether, airport operators said in a statement.
